5 Dangers of Hard Water in Hendersonville, TN

Hard water contains high levels of magnesium, calcium, and other dissolved minerals. As it works through your home’s pipes and appliances, it can have a negative impact. Learn more about some potential dangers of hard water to your Hendersonville, TN household below.

Clogged Pipes

Over time, mineral deposits from hard water can build up in your home’s pipes. This can lead to clogs and reduced water flow. You might notice slower drainage and a decrease in your water pressure until a plumber can come and tackle the clog.

Damage to Appliances

Various household appliances can sustain damage as a result of hard water. Some of the most common appliances in this category include washing machines, dishwashers, and water heaters.

As you run hard water through these appliances, the minerals start to accumulate, making parts work harder to get the same outcome. Your appliances might not last as long, and your utility bills may start to increase over time as a result.

Reduced Effectiveness of Soap

When you are using laundry detergent or dish soap, you might notice that they are not as effective in cleaning your clothing and dishes. This is due to hard water making it harder for soaps and detergents to lather, reducing their effectiveness.

Scale Buildup Inside Water Fixtures

If you have hard water, keep an eye on your fixtures, such as your showerheads and faucets. You may notice scale building up that is hard to clean off. Over time, this can decrease the efficiency of your fixtures and corrode them.

Soap Scum

Soap and hard water react with each other to cause soap scum, which is a scaly and sticky residue. It is common for this to accumulate in your shower or bathtub when you have hard water. Soap scum is very difficult to clean and might require harsh cleaners to remove it.

You can see that hard water can do a number on different elements of your home. Professionals can come to assess your home’s water and let you know if water softeners are a good choice.
